Spiritual & cultural context
A name representing a journey of spiritual growth, self-discovery, and closeness to Allah.
The name "Tazkia" carries a deep cultural significance in the Islamic community. It represents a commitment to personal growth and self-improvement, which aligns with the broader cultural values of Islam emphasizing moral character, spiritual development, and a constant striving towards righteousness. The term is often used in the context of educational institutions or educational programs that aim to cultivate virtuous individuals, hence the name "Tazkia Centers." This moniker is a powerful reminder of the Islamic belief in the importance of continuous learning and self-refinement.
